I'm trying to use Joom Donation 3.8 to accept 'donations' for a banquet. There are different donation amounts depending on the number of each type of person, i.e. 2 adults at $10/ea and 3 kids at $5/ea.. how do I convert 2 adults and 3 kids to an amount that gets sent to PayPal?

Hi Bruce
There is no way to convert to make it works like that. Maybe you can go to Joom Donation => Configuration, enter different pre-defined amounts and then pre-defined amounts explanation (For example, there will be an amount with 10$ and the corresponding explanation is adults.... and so on)
Then when users access to donation form, they can select from the pre-defined amount you setup (with the text description next to each amount)
That's the only way to setup for now
